PEG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

1,302 of the 8,279 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Public Service Enterprise Group (PEG)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$31.2B — up 3.4% from $30.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 128 funds opened new PEG positions and 90 closed out — a net gain of 38 holders — while 550 added to existing stakes and 397 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$273M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$282M.
